Effect Of Adding Matured Compost On The Humification Process Of Aerobic Kitchen Waste Composting

Abstract/Summary:
Kitchen waste is perishable and rich in organic matter and nutrient elements,which shows immense potential in biological treatment.Aerobic composting embodies several characteristics like high temperature,fast fermentation,low operating cost,which make it possible for the resource regeneration of kitchen waste.Nevertheless,when processed with aerobic composting,kitchen waste which is of high moisture content and poor pore structure commonly requires a certain amount of additives.Matured compost obtained by aerobic fermentation is of low moisture content,developed pores and rich microbial communities.All these advantages make it become a common-used compost additive.In this paper,fermentation parameters of kitchen waste composting were optimized by orthogonal experiments.Subsequently,effects of adding different proportions of matured compost on the physico-chemical properties and humus acid of compost were studied under the optimized parameters.Finally,a drum composting reactor utilizing matured compost as additive was designed and then optimized by simulation.All efforts mentioned above were made to provide a certain theoretical basis for practical application of matured compost additive.The main findings are listed as follows:(1)Orthogonal test results showed that all experimental groups remains above 50℃for more than 10 days.All meet the hygienic requirements for composting temperature.After 40-day aerobic composting,all groups realized obvious reduction effect and were decomposed.Turning frequency have most significant effect on accumulated temperature,and it was followed by ventilation and moisture content;When it comes to factors influencing the degradation rate of organic matter,ventilation was the highest,followed by turning frequency,then moisture content.The results revealed that the optimal levels of factor for the aerobic composting were 0.10 m3·(min)-1 for ventilation,60%for moisture content and the 8 d for turnover frequency.(2)Compared with the control group added with sawdust,adding matured compost extended the duration of high temperature above 55℃by 1-3 d in experimental groups,and it was conducive to non-hazardous treatment of kitchen waste.Its adding improved the initial p H value in compost,which reduced the influence of acidification to metabolism of microorganisms.Adding matured compost significantly increased the electrical conductivity and the content of organic nitrogen,ammonium nitrogen and nitrate nitrogen,reduced the organic carbon content,and maintained the C/N ratio within an appropriate range.It actually facilitated the conversion of ammonium nitrogen to nitrate nitrogen and the control of nitrogen loss.Therefore,its addition was beneficial to improve the nutrient content in compost product,but restrained the degradation of the organic carbon slightly in the meantime.Results indicated that the optimal mixing ratio of matured compost and kitchen waste was 0.8:1~1.6:1.When this ratio was 0.8:1,compost maturity reached the best.(3)Each component of humic acid showed downward trend as the composting proceeded.At the end of experiment,the content of humic acid increased with the rising proportion of matured compost,while the loss rate of humic acid decreased gradually.Its addition improved the E4/E6 ratio by 20.0%on average,and the HA/FA ratio decreased by 5.3%on average at the same time.When the content of reducing sugars and amino acids gradually decreased during composting,the content of polyphenols increased first and then decreased.The activities of dehydrogenase,catalase and polyphenol oxidase showed a rising trend.Matured compost additive inhibited the decomposition of humic acid,which can improve the concentration of humic acid and compost fertility effectively.Adding matured compost significantly increased the content of reducing sugars,amino acids and polyphenols,as well as the activities of dehydrogenase and polyphenol oxidase during composting,while catalase activity showed a slightly drop.Its addition was conducive to the formation and accumulation of humic acid.In the meantime,it suppressed the growth of polymerization and aromatization degree of humus acid to a certain extent.Therefore,the mixing ratio be lower than 1.6:1.(4)Filling rate had the most significant influence on the reflux effect of matured compost in the newly designed drum composting reactor.The optimized rotate speed was1 r/min,filling rate was 40%,and number of plates was 3 sets.When ran under the above conditions for only 51 minutes,the reflux ratio of reactor reached 80%,which means that after optimized,the designed reactor is capable of mixing fresh material with matured compost efficiently.Gasflow simulation results showed that with the increase of the pores spacing in ventilation pipe in the reactor,the gas flow rate and dynamic pressure in pipe increased gradually,and the airflow could cover a larger area and distribute more evenly.In consequence,the pores spacing in ventilation pipe should be set to 70 mm.
